Granted

The Veteran's mental health disability was found to be severe enough to cause unemployability from November 10, 2021, making him eligible for special monthly compensation (SMC) at the housebound rate.

The deciding factor: The Veteran's mental health symptoms alone were deemed adequate in severity to render him unemployable, meeting the criteria for SMC based on statutory housebound status.
